Xicotepec de Juárez's air quality reflects the Puebla Sierra Norte's Necaxa River valley at 1,110 metres, with vehicle traffic on surrounding roads and the coffee, orange, and agricultural corridor contributing local sources. The surrounding mountain ranges create significant topographic enclosure, while the tropical highland climate's frequent rain provides effective atmospheric cleansing and Xicotepec generally maintains moderate to good Mexican eastern Sierra Norte highland valley readings throughout most of the year.

Are air quality levels in Xicotepec de Juárez based on measurements or forecasts?

It is forecasts derived by downscaling forecasts provided by EU’s Copernicus Atmosphere Monitoring Service (CAMS) by taking into account local conditions such as traffic patterns. CAMS bases its forecast on satellite measurements of particles and chemical compounds in the atmosphere.
